Q: May I have a personal message, please, Ham? A: Yes, my son, you do well. Continue to seek that total orientation toward spiritual truth. Allow yourself to be pulled more and more toward the Master's spirit. Be careful not to let your old ideas about him come between you. Human beings are still a little afraid of the power of the spirit and so Jesus, for many people, is a manageable one, he is the Jesus of childhood, the baby Jesus at Christmas time, the redeemer, the static point in history when sins were paid for, somehow. They reduce him to an intellectual concept rather than spiritual reality that he is. It is always hard to break through those old conceptions, those old colorings of what the Master's spirit is and how he relates to human beings. Keep this in mind when dealing with others who may not be ready to take that faith leap from the Jesus on the cross as the dead conception and Jesus the living spiritual friend. You, my son, are working through many things and much of this work is still the cleaning away of the old. Do this with him. Ask him to help you when you are ready. Is this helping your understanding?
